hello, we are looking to move to Long Island and start a new family.
Baldwin seems to have the most affordable house price while having decent school.
is this a good area? is it safe? is it diverse?
we are looking for some multi family, is it easy to get a good tenant?
Certain areas are nice. Some not so nice.
Schools are ok. Town of Hempstead doesn't like 2 family homes so make sure any of the ones you look at are legit. Ask to see permits.

Baldwin is fine. It's diverse. Decent schools. Good commute to NYC.
Baldwin is awesome, its one of the best bang for the buck areas on the South Shore. I agree with what the general consensus is - stay south of sunrise for what you are asking. North Baldwin is a little rough, although its got some good pockets on the north side - anything near grand avenue is going to be an eye sore for you and your guests.
I hope Grand Avenue changes - but its been that way for decades.
South of Sunrise is a completely different experience, large property sizes (for the south shore) ranging from 7500 sq ft -.25 acres. 95% of houses are well kept, no loitering - new Police Dept right on Merrick (#1) - Fire Dept. right around the corner.
Keep in mind that 80s babies are now moving into this area and starting families, which means you have tons of College Educated professionals moving to Baldwin because its affordable, I myself included.
My block is so mixed, it reminds me of my old neighborhood in Queens. My neighbors on one side are Irish, the other side African American - Across the street - West Indian, next to them Chinese (been there for 67 Years) - the entire block has this makeup. Everyone is around the same age group and has kids - Everyone looks out for each other and there is no animosity.
Property values are rising as well - as is all of NY, but I have a feeling in the years to come, Baldwin will develop a better reputation as waves of professionals from all around NY are moving here - its happening now, so don't buy into some of the Old Timers on here abhorrent to change.
